
一、直接回答问题:
清理Excel中的图片可以通过手动删除、使用VBA代码、使用Excel内置的“选择对象”工具等方法来实现。手动删除是最为简单的方法,可以逐一选择并删除图片。使用VBA代码可以批量删除图片,适合处理大量图片的情况。使用Excel内置的“选择对象”工具可以快速选择所有图片并进行删除。下面将详细介绍使用VBA代码的方法。VBA代码是一种强大的工具,可以通过简单的代码快速删除所有图片,只需几步就能完成操作。
二、清理Excel图片的具体方法
一、手动删除图片
手动删除图片是最为直观和简单的方法,适用于图片数量较少的情况。
1.1、逐一删除
- 打开需要清理图片的Excel文件。
- 选择要删除的图片。
- 按键盘上的“Delete”键即可删除选中的图片。
- 重复以上步骤,直到删除所有不需要的图片。
1.2、使用“选择对象”工具
- 在Excel中,点击“开始”选项卡。
- 在“编辑”组中,点击“查找和选择”,然后选择“选择对象”。
- 使用鼠标框选所有图片。
- 按“Delete”键删除所有选中的图片。
二、使用VBA代码删除图片
对于需要批量删除图片的情况,使用VBA代码是最为高效的方法。
2.1、打开VBA编辑器
- 按“Alt + F11”打开VBA编辑器。
- 在VBA编辑器中,点击“插入”,选择“模块”插入一个新的模块。
2.2、输入VBA代码
在新插入的模块中,输入以下VBA代码:
Sub DeleteAllPictures()
Dim ws As Worksheet
Dim pic As Picture
For Each ws In ThisWorkbook.Worksheets
For Each pic In ws.Pictures
pic.Delete
Next pic
Next ws
End Sub
2.3、运行代码
- 按“F5”键或点击“运行”按钮运行该代码。
- 代码将遍历工作簿中的所有工作表,并删除每个工作表中的所有图片。
三、使用Excel内置工具
Excel内置了一些便捷的工具,可以帮助用户快速选择和删除图片。
3.1、使用“选择对象”工具
- 在“开始”选项卡中,点击“查找和选择”。
- 选择“选择对象”,然后使用鼠标框选所有图片。
- 按“Delete”键删除选中的图片。
3.2、使用“对象定位器”
- 在Excel中,按“Ctrl + G”打开“定位”对话框。
- 点击“定位条件”,选择“对象”。
- 点击“确定”后,Excel将选择所有对象(包括图片)。
- 按“Delete”键删除所有选中的对象。
四、使用第三方工具
有些第三方工具和插件也可以帮助清理Excel中的图片。
4.1、使用Kutools for Excel
Kutools for Excel是一款功能强大的Excel插件,提供了许多便利的工具。
- 安装并启动Kutools for Excel。
- 在Kutools选项卡中,找到“删除”工具组。
- 点击“删除图片”按钮,即可删除工作表中的所有图片。
4.2、使用Power Query
Power Query是一款数据处理工具,也可以用于清理Excel中的图片。
- 打开Power Query编辑器。
- 导入包含图片的工作表。
- 删除包含图片的列或行。
五、注意事项
在清理Excel中的图片时,需要注意以下几点:
5.1、备份文件
在进行任何删除操作之前,最好备份文件,以防误删除重要内容。
5.2、检查结果
在删除图片后,检查工作表是否有遗漏的图片或其他需要删除的对象。
5.3、合理使用工具
根据图片数量和清理需求,选择合适的工具和方法进行操作。
六、总结
清理Excel中的图片可以通过手动删除、使用VBA代码、使用Excel内置工具等多种方法实现。手动删除适用于图片数量较少的情况,操作简单直接。使用VBA代码可以批量删除图片,适合处理大量图片的情况,代码编写和运行相对简单。使用Excel内置工具可以快速选择和删除图片,是一种便捷的方法。此外,第三方工具如Kutools for Excel也提供了便捷的图片清理功能。在清理图片时,务必备份文件,并在删除后仔细检查结果,以确保操作的准确性和安全性。
相关问答FAQs:
1. 如何清理Excel中的插入图片?
- 问题描述:我想知道如何从Excel中删除或清理插入的图片。
- 回答:要清理Excel中的插入图片,您可以按照以下步骤进行操作:
- 在Excel工作表中,选择您要清理图片的单元格。
- 在Excel菜单栏中,选择“插入”选项卡。
- 在“插入”选项卡中,找到“图片”或“形状”按钮,并单击它。
- 在弹出的窗口中,选择要清理的图片,并点击“删除”或“清除”选项。
- 确认删除或清除操作后,图片将被从Excel中清理掉。
2. 怎样批量清理Excel中的插入图片?
- 问题描述:我有一个包含大量插入图片的Excel文件,想要一次性清理掉这些图片,有没有简便的方法?
- 回答:确实有一种简便的方法可以批量清理Excel中的插入图片,您可以按照以下步骤进行操作:
- 在Excel工作表中,按下键盘上的“Ctrl”和“A”键,将整个工作表中的内容选中。
- 在Excel菜单栏中,选择“开始”选项卡。
- 在“编辑”组中,找到“查找和选择”按钮,并单击它。
- 在弹出的菜单中,选择“Goto特殊”选项。
- 在“Goto特殊”对话框中,选择“对象”选项,并点击“确定”按钮。
- Excel将自动选中所有插入的图片,然后您可以按下键盘上的“Delete”键或右键点击并选择“删除”来清理这些图片。
3. 如何清理Excel中的隐藏图片?
- 问题描述:我发现在Excel中有些图片被隐藏了,想要清理掉这些隐藏图片,请问怎么操作?
- 回答:如果您想要清理Excel中的隐藏图片,可以按照以下步骤进行操作:
- 在Excel工作表中,右键点击任意位置并选择“查看代码”。
- 在打开的“Microsoft Visual Basic for Applications”窗口中,选择“插入”选项卡。
- 在“插入”选项卡中,选择“模块”选项。
- 在模块窗口中,粘贴以下代码:
Sub ClearHiddenPictures() Dim pic As Picture For Each pic In ActiveSheet.Pictures If pic.Visible = False Then pic.Delete End If Next pic End Sub - 按下键盘上的“F5”键执行代码。
- 执行完毕后,所有隐藏的图片将被清理掉。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4905359